Thomas Appling Iii lives in San Jose, CA. Thomas has worked for Office Depot and Sales Executive. Jobs Thomas has held in the past include Finance Executive.
  • Office Depot
  • Sales Executive
  • Finance Executive

Public Records

Arrest Records

Scroll